Performance and Engine
The Wrangler Rubicon is built around strong low-speed performance and four-wheel-drive capability rather than simply chasing straight-line speed.
Depending on the market and configuration, the Wrangler range can be offered with different powertrain choices, including turbocharged petrol and electrified options. The exact engine lineup for the 2026 model can vary by market.
The Rubicon’s four-wheel-drive hardware is its biggest performance advantage. Low-range gearing helps provide additional control when climbing steep surfaces, crossing rocks, or driving through mud.
The SUV is also designed to handle water crossings and challenging trails, although drivers should always follow the vehicle’s specified limits and use appropriate off-road techniques.
Off-Road Features
The 2026 Wrangler Rubicon remains focused on serious trail driving. Its equipment can include features such as electronic locking differentials, a disconnecting front sway bar, low-range four-wheel drive, specialized off-road tyres, and increased ground clearance.
These features work together to improve traction and wheel articulation on difficult terrain.
The Rubicon’s high approach and departure angles also help it deal with steep obstacles. The underbody is designed with off-road use in mind, while the available trail-focused systems give drivers greater control over difficult surfaces.
For experienced off-road enthusiasts, this capability is one of the strongest reasons to choose a Wrangler Rubicon over a conventional SUV.
